Wolfsburg interested in Benteke

Bundesliga side Wolfsburg will make a summer bid for Aston Villa striker Christian Benteke, according to a German source.
The Belgian international has been in goal-scoring form for the Villans in recent months, and this has attracted interest from top clubs in Europe.
According to German sports daily Bild, the Wolves are keen to challenge Bayern Munich for the Bundesliga next season, and consider Benteke as the perfect player to provide them with a boost upfront.
Reports elsewhere suggest that Tim Sherwood would be willing to part ways with the star striker, should any club match their asking price of £30m.
